Solution for 6x-40=x+y equation:


Simplifying
6x + -40 = x + y

Reorder the terms:
-40 + 6x = x + y

Solving
-40 + 6x = x + y

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-1x' to each side of the equation.
-40 + 6x + -1x = x + -1x + y

Combine like terms: 6x + -1x = 5x
-40 + 5x = x + -1x + y

Combine like terms: x + -1x = 0
-40 + 5x = 0 + y
-40 + 5x = y

Add '40' to each side of the equation.
-40 + 40 + 5x = 40 + y

Combine like terms: -40 + 40 = 0
0 + 5x = 40 + y
5x = 40 + y

Divide each side by '5'.
x = 8 + 0.2y

Simplifying
x = 8 + 0.2y
